Oldest Ancestor of Modern Sea Turtles Was — A Sea Turtle

TL;DR


Summary:
- This article discusses the discovery of the oldest known ancestor of modern sea turtles, a species that lived around 120 million years ago.
- The ancient sea turtle, named Desmatochelys padillai, was found in what is now Colombia and had a shell and flippers similar to modern sea turtles, indicating it was well-adapted to a marine environment.
- The discovery of this ancient sea turtle provides important insights into the evolution of these reptiles and how they adapted to life in the ocean over millions of years.
